Car
If you're driving to Ulsanbawi, start by heading towards Seoraksan National Park from Sokcho. Enter the park via the Seoraksan Entrance. Follow the signs to the Ulsanbawi Parking Area. The drive will take approximately 30 minutes. Once you arrive at the parking area, you will need to pay a parking fee of around 2,000 KRW. From the parking area, follow the well-marked hiking trail to reach Ulsanbawi. The hike is about 3.5 km and takes roughly 2 hours to complete.
Public Transportation
If you are using public transportation, take a bus from Sokcho to Seoraksan National Park. Buses leave from the Sokcho Intercity Bus Terminal, and the fare is typically around 2,500 KRW. The bus ride takes about 30 minutes. Once you arrive at the park entrance, pay the entrance fee of 3,500 KRW for adults. From the park entrance, you can either walk or take a local shuttle bus to the Ulsanbawi Parking Area. The hike to Ulsanbawi from the parking area will be about 3.5 km, taking approximately 2 hours.
